ILLINOIS - Mary Miller will face Jennifer Todd in the race to represent Illinois’s 15th Congressional District.

During the March 17, 2026, primary, Republicans Judy Bowlby and Ryan Tebrugge challenged incumbent Mary Miller for the Republican nomination. Democrats Paul Davis, Kyle Nudo, Randy Raley and Jennifer Todd faced off for the Democratic nomination.

Miller received 73.6% of votes while Bowlby took 11.5% of votes and Tebrugge took 14.9% of votes. Davis had 33.9% of votes, Nudo had 9.1% of votes, Raley had 11.5% of votes, and Todd received 45.5% of votes.

Miller won the Republican nomination and Todd won the Democratic nomination. The two will vie for the seat during the general election on Nov. 3, 2026.

Illinois’s 15th Congressional District includes parts of Springfield, Decatur, Quincy, Edwardsville and Glen Carbon. Miller has held the seat since 2021.
